Protecting Women and Children in Lesotho
Sep. 2024
Today, Prince Harry, Duke of Sussex joined Her Majesty Queen Masenate Mohato Seeiso for a pivotal side-event at the United Nations General Assembly. This gathering aimed to advance crucial discussions surrounding the recognition and protection of women and children as essential drivers of sustainable development and peace in Lesotho and beyond.
In his remarks, the Duke expressed unwavering support for Her Majesty and the kingdom of Lesotho, emphasizing the vital role that women and children play in fostering societal progress. He highlighted how empowering these groups not only strengthens communities but also serves as a foundation for long-lasting peace and progress.
“We know that together we can build a better future. We know education and childhood development are the foundations of national peace and prosperity. Investing in these areas is critical if we are to break our generational cycles, not just in Lesotho but around the world.” – Prince Harry, Duke of Sussex
The Duke’s participation highlights the importance of international collaboration in advancing these vital discussions and ensuring that the voices of women and children are heard on the global stage.
